Handover — cron drift investigation, Pellwick scheduler. For future maintainers: Ostra and I traced the 40-second drift on the Fenholm batch hosts to an NTP peer flapping after the kernel upgrade. Mitigation is in place; the permanent fix lands next sprint. The drift dashboard's admin console sealed itself during our testing, so you may need to unseal it. Use the recovery passphrase that follows.

unlock words, fahop-yageg: ralwyn-kelath

## CSV Import Wizard — Release Notes Access

As release manager, you are responsible for verifying that the Gristmill CSV import wizard passes its staging smoke tests before each cut. The smoke harness calls the internal Rowforge validation service to replay sample imports, and that call is authenticated with a shared service key rather than individual accounts. Please confirm the key is present in the release environment before triggering the pipeline, and file a rotation request if any test logs leak it. The current key is listed below.

app token of badug-tahaf = qvz11-nP5FBNr8qnh

// REINDEX_BATCH_CAP limits docs per shard pass in the Tallowfield
// nightly search reindex. Raising it starves the ingest queue;
// lowering it overruns the maintenance window. 5000 is the tested
// sweet spot. Change only with a soak run. Verified against the
// build noted below.

session token of bawif-hahog = htk6_ac5981

Subject: Sproutline cut-over done

Team,

The plant-watering scheduler cut over to the new Sproutline backend this morning. All customer schedules migrated; valve commands now route through the regional broker. Legacy scheduler is read-only until Friday, then retired. Expect a few tickets about shifted watering times — schedules were normalized to local time. The new service runs with the configuration below.

settings of tagef-bawif:
DRUIX_HOST=druix.zemvarlabs.internal
DRUIX_PORT=8000